Transaction 784681331b208504aee8fdd9ca6c488c76f7b60e1f7df591f10f9295f905fae2
1 Input
1 Output
-
784681331b208504aee8fdd9ca6c488c76f7b60e1f7df591f10f9295f905fae2:0
- value
- 23632270
- script pubkey
- OP_0 OP_PUSHBYTES_20 8b17e89971dff762541ae48c2ab602886fbbab2b
- address
- bc1q3vt73xt3mlmky4q6ujxz4dsz3phmh2ethaevzv